Job description
Perform standard Linux System Administration duties as required to maintain smooth operation of multi-user computer systems consisting of Linux based application and license servers, virtual machines, and GP/GPU cluster based systems. Coordination with network administrators required. Additional duties are:
-
Setting up administrator and service accounts, maintaining system documentation, tuning system performance, installing system wide software and allocate mass storage space.
-
Developing and monitoring policies and standards for allocation related to the use of computing resources.
-
Participating in the installation, integration, acceptance testing, and on-going maintenance of our HPC systems and software environment.
-
Assisting with forecast resource limitations and provide recommendations for increasing the efficiency of our resources through proper scheduling and load balancing techniques.
